

Enthusiasts of the adored anime and manga franchise “One Piece” can now set sail on a thrilling new journey thanks to LEGO’s recent partnership with Netflix. For the very first time, LEGO has introduced a collection of sets inspired by the live-action version of “One Piece,” enabling fans to reconstruct iconic moments from the series using bricks. This collaboration featuring Netflix and Tomorrow Studios brings Eiichiro Oda’s legendary universe to reality, presenting seven distinctive sets that embody unforgettable scenes from Season One of Netflix’s “One Piece.”
Among the standout pieces in this lineup is the LEGO “One Piece” Going Merry Pirate Ship set, which contains 1,376 pieces and showcases intricately designed interiors along with minifigures of cherished characters like Luffy, Zoro, Nami, Usopp, and Sanji. The ship’s construction boasts the instantly recognizable sails of the Straw Hat Pirates, making it an essential addition for series fans.
Besides the Going Merry Pirate Ship, fans can anticipate six additional sets, each representing a crucial scene from the live-action adaptation. These sets feature:
– #75640: The Baratie Floating Restaurant – 3,402 pieces for $329.99
– #75639: The Going Merry Pirate Ship – 1,376 pieces for $139.99
– #75638: Battle at Arlong Park – 926 pieces for $79.99
– #75637: Buggy the Clown’s Circus Tent – 573 pieces for $54.99
– #75636: Windmill Village Hut – 299 pieces for $29.99
